Fallout 4 is an action role-playing game developed by Bethesda Game
Studios and published by Bethesda Softworks. It is the fourth main
game in the Fallout series and was released worldwide on November 10,
2015, for Microsoft Windows, PlayStation 4 and Xbox One. The game is
set within an open world post-apocalyptic environment that encompasses
the city of Boston and the surrounding Massachusetts region known as
"The Commonwealth". It makes use of a number of local landmarks,
including Bunker Hill, Fort Independence (Massachusetts), and Old
North Bridge near Concord, as the bridge out of Sanctuary Hills.The
main story takes place in the year 2287, ten years after the events of
Fallout 3 and 210 years after "The Great War", which caused
catastrophic nuclear devastation across the United States.The player
assumes control of a character referred to as the "Sole Survivor", who
emerges from a long-term cryogenic stasis in Vault 111, an underground
nuclear fallout shelter. After witnessing the murder of their spouse
and kidnapping of their son, the Sole Survivor ventures out into the
Commonwealth to search for their missing child. The player explores
the game's dilapidated world, completes various quests, helps out
factions, and acquires experience points to level up and increase the
abilities of their character. New features to the series include the
ability to develop and manage settlements and an extensive crafting
system where materials scavenged from the environment can be used to
craft drugs and explosives, upgrade weapons and armor, and construct,
furnish and improve settlements. Fallout 4 also marks the first game
in the series to feature full voice acting for the protagonist.
